What Are Lawsuit Funding Services?
Lawsuit funding services are financial resources provided to plaintiffs involved in litigation. These services allow individuals to receive a cash advance based on the expected settlement or verdict of their case. Often used in personal injury or other civil litigation cases, lawsuit funding helps cover medical bills, living expenses, and legal fees while the case is being processed.

How Do Lawsuit Funding Services in Southfield, Michigan Work?
The process of obtaining lawsuit funding in Southfield is relatively straightforward. Here’s a basic overview:
- Application: The plaintiff applies for lawsuit funding by submitting relevant case information to the funding provider. This includes details about the nature of the lawsuit and expected settlement or verdict.
- Case Evaluation: The funding company evaluates the case, often working with legal professionals to determine the likelihood of success and potential settlement amount.
- Approval: Once the evaluation is complete, the funding company approves or denies the application based on the risk of the case.
- Advance Payment: If approved, the plaintiff receives a cash advance, which can be used to cover expenses while the case is pending.
- Repayment: When the case is successfully settled or the court awards a verdict, the lawsuit funding company receives the repayment, usually a percentage of the settlement or award.
Unlike traditional loans, lawsuit funding is non-recourse, meaning if you lose your case, you do not have to repay the advance.

Types of Cases Covered by Lawsuit Funding Services in Southfield, Michigan
Lawsuit funding services cover a wide range of case types, including:
- Personal Injury Lawsuits: Injuries resulting from car accidents, slip and falls, medical malpractice, and workplace accidents are common cases for lawsuit funding.
- Wrongful Death Cases: Family members of victims who died due to negligence or wrongful actions can apply for funding during the lawsuit.
- Employment Disputes: Lawsuits related to wrongful termination, discrimination, or harassment can also be covered by lawsuit funding services.
- Class Action Lawsuits: Plaintiffs involved in class action lawsuits can also apply for lawsuit funding to help cover expenses during the litigation process.
